Pentax K100D vs Sony WX220 Overview

Following is a extended assessment of the Pentax K100D versus Sony WX220, former is a Entry-Level DSLR while the other is a Ultracompact by rivals Pentax and Sony. There exists a considerable gap between the resolutions of the K100D (6MP) and WX220 (18MP) and the K100D (APS-C) and WX220 (1/2.3") come with totally different sensor sizes.

Pentax K100D vs Sony WX220 Physical Comparison

For anybody who is looking to carry around your camera, you have to consider its weight and proportions. The Pentax K100D has exterior measurements of 129mm x 93mm x 70mm (5.1" x 3.7" x 2.8") and a weight of 660 grams (1.46 lbs) whilst the Sony WX220 has measurements of 92mm x 52mm x 22mm (3.6" x 2.0" x 0.9") with a weight of 121 grams (0.27 lbs).

Pentax K100D vs Sony WX220 Sensor Comparison

Typically, it's hard to envision the gap between sensor sizes purely by reading a spec sheet. The picture here will help give you a better sense of the sensor measurements in the K100D and WX220.

Clearly, both of these cameras enjoy different megapixel count and different sensor sizes. The K100D featuring a larger sensor will make achieving shallower DOF less difficult and the Sony WX220 will offer you greater detail utilizing its extra 12MP. Greater resolution will make it easier to crop pics far more aggressively. The more aged K100D is going to be disadvantaged when it comes to sensor innovation.
